According to Herodotus, at the climax of a lengthy war for control of present-day Turkey, A battle took place in which it happened, when the fight had begun, that suddenly the day became night. The Lydians, however, and the Medes, when they saw that it had become night instead of day, ceased from their fighting and were much more eager, both of them, that peace should be made between them. Modern astronomers have now determined that an eclipse occurred on May 28, 585 BC, at the location of the battle.
